Paid SSL certificates serve to guarantee the authenticity of public keys, and are capable of providing a higher level of reliability and security.
Sometimes it is forgotten how important paid SSL certificates really are, and how important it is to use them. Paid SSL certificates are issued by certified authorities and recognised by all browsers. Similarly, paid SSL certificates provide full encryption, and come with the issuer’s warranty.

SSL certificates enable encrypted data transfer between users and servers, providing secure data traffic. All ongoing traffic is encrypted, so if this information happens to be intercepted at any point, it still cannot be read or modified in any way. SSL certificates use encryption keys of various different lengths (128-bit, 256-bit, etc.) that guarantee data security and protection against unauthorised access.
